25 Fun Facts Learned Thus Far (First 5 days) You don’t stand in a “line”, you stand in a “queue”. They’re not “fries”, they’re “chips”. They say “half 9, half 10, etc.”…meaning 9:30, 10:30. Electrical outlets have 2 prongs on the bottom and one on top. When a light switch is down, it is on, … Continue reading
